  • UnderstandMouseMagicUnderstandMouseMagic Member Posts: 2,147
    The room you get the task to retrieve the heart of the rival isn't a "problem" magic room.

    First one to the west from the entrance, dead magic, kill the warring demons in there (or watch them kill each other and step in at the end).

    Then west again, arrive in the room, all magic stripped because of the previous room. But then you can cast at will.
    You don't have to be evil to get the quest, just "not good".
    If you are good they attack after a bit of dialog (which is a problem because you arrive in the room with no prep, no buffs ect.)

    If not good aligned, the easiest thing to do is agree to get the heart, convene in a corner, buff your party and summons, force attack if you want the XP.
